Import "py_translate" could not be resolved
时间: 2023-12-29 22:01:44 浏览: 24
如果在使用 `py_translate` 库时遇到了 `Import "py_translate" could not be resolved` 错误,可能是因为你的开发环境没有正确配置。以下是一些可能的解决方案:
1. 检查是否正确安装了 `py_translate` 库。可以在终端或命令提示符窗口中运行 `pip show py-translate` 命令来查看是否已安装该库。
2. 检查开发环境是否正确配置了 Python 解释器。如果你使用的是 Visual Studio Code,可以在设置中搜索 Python Path 并设置正确的 Python 解释器路径。
3. 尝试在代码中使用 `from translate import Translator` 或 `from translate import Translator, exceptions` 来导入 `translate` 模块。如果这样导入仍然无法解决问题,可以尝试重新安装 `translate` 库。
4. 如果你使用的是 PyCharm,可以尝试刷新项目依赖并重启 PyCharm。在 PyCharm 中,可以通过点击 File -> Invalidate Caches / Restart 来刷新项目依赖和重启 PyCharm。
如果以上方法均无法解决问题,请尝试更新开发环境或重装开发环境。
相关问题
Import "netifaces" could not be resolved
回答: 根据引用\[1\]中的描述,"Import 'netifaces' could not be resolved"的错误可能是在使用rosdep时遇到的问题。根据引用\[3\]中的解决方法,您可以尝试找到rosdep.py文件,通常位于/usr/bin/目录下。然后,确认您的Python版本是2.7,并运行"python rosdep.py"命令来解决这个问题。这样应该能够解决"Import 'netifaces' could not be resolved"的错误。
#### 引用[.reference_title]
- *1* *2* [(一)ROS系统入门 Getting Started with ROS 以Kinetic为主更新 附课件PPT](https://blog.csdn.net/ZhangRelay/article/details/53760609)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[Ubuntu-18.04 安装 ROS 系统](https://blog.csdn.net/BeeGreen/article/details/105654034)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
Import ".occ_reid" could not be resolved
The error message "Import ".occ_reid" could not be resolved" indicates that the Python interpreter is unable to find the module named "occ_reid". This could be due to a few reasons:
1. The module is not installed: You need to make sure that the module is installed on your system. You can install it using pip command: `pip install occ_reid`.
2. The module is installed but not in the Python path: If the module is installed but not in the Python path, you can add its location to the path using the following code:
```
import sys
sys.path.append('/path/to/occ_reid')
```
Replace `/path/to/occ_reid` with the actual path to the module.
3. The module is not in the same directory as your code: If the module is in a different directory than your code, you need to specify the path to the module using the dot notation. For example, if the module is in a directory called `utils` and your code is in the root directory, you can import it like this:
```
from utils.occ_reid import some_function
```
Make sure to replace `some_function` with the actual function name you want to use from the module.